AI on the edge as a paradigm promises unparalleled energy efficiency and data privacy among other benefits. This has resulted in a rising trend of approaches to bring AI computing near or embedded directly inside a sensing element. In this paper, we describe a workflow of executing contemporary deep learning applications along with schemes to overcome the challenges of implementing this class of applications in a resource-constrained computing environment. We demonstrate the performance on a state-of-the-art AI-capable MEMS IMU sensor product from STMicroelectronics called the Intelligent Sensor Processing Unit (ISPU)
